Introducing Salesframe and vPlaybook

Salesframe, and vPlaybook belong to a category of solutions that help Sales Enablement. Different products excel in different areas, so the best platform for your business will depend on your specific needs and requirements.

Salesframe covers Engagement Management with Omnichannel, Knowledge Management, Distribution Management, Business Development, etc.

vPlaybook focuses on Playbook Creation with Video, Engagement Management with Video, Training & Onboarding with Offline, Conversion Management with Phone Calls, etc.
